1963 – 2003

FARMINGTONKevin J. “Rugrat” Bellegarde, 39, of Dixfield, died Wednesday, May 14, at the Franklin Memorial Hospital. He lived on the Wilton Road in Dixfield and had lived in the area all of his life

Born in Rumford, Oct. 17, 1963, the son of Roland and Mary Anne (LeBlanc) Bellegarde, he graduated from Rumford High School in the Class of 1983.

He was employed as a mechanic at Casey’s Auto Sales in Mexico. He loved to hunt and fish and loved the outdoors, snowmobiling and loved spending time with family. Following a car accident which left him disabled, he was determined to move on.

He was married in Dixfield, on Feb. 14, 1988 to Laura Brown who survives of Dixfield.

Other survivors include sons, Jeremy Bellegarde and Stephen Averill and a daughter, Jessica Brown, all of Dixfield; parents, Roland and Mary Anne Bellegarde of Rumford; sisters, Karen White and husband, Roger of Rumford, Nancy Norberg and husband, Kevin of South Portland, Wanda Child and husband, Tom of Peru, Linda Law and husband, David of Dixfield and Brenda Smith and husband, Dan of Scarborough.
